Output 79ae61149241f753143385122c834bf25863ea52999ab511f101c6dae65f97a5:0

value
42932343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d94931956a336db953baaf500060d3401299acb0 OP_EQUALVERIFY OP_CHECKSIG
address
Lf2raRhcjTvL8XXDZsZhzM9dXrCFq35UAw
transaction
79ae61149241f753143385122c834bf25863ea52999ab511f101c6dae65f97a5
spent
true